A man has been arrested in connection with the murder of a 23-year-old Norwegian student found in a basement of a block of flats in central London.
Martine Vik Magnussen's body was discovered under rubble in a block of flats in Great Portland Street.
She was last seen leaving Mayfair's Maddox Club in the early hours of 14 March. She died from neck injuries.
The man, from St Johns Wood in north-west London, was questioned on suspicion of assisting an offender.
The man, who is in his 50s, was released on bail until May. He was arrested on Wednesday, police said.
Ms Vik Magnussen, who comes from a wealthy Norwegian family, had been a student at Regents Business School, Regents Park, since 2007.
Officers want to speak to fellow student Farouk Abdulhak who left for Yemen on the day Ms Vik Magnussen vanished. His current whereabouts are unknown.
Police said Yemeni national Mr Abdulhak was seen with Ms Vik Magnussen on the day she went missing.
